CI note: the Wrenfall websocket tests fail intermittently when permessage-deflate is enabled on small frames — compression overhead exceeds savings and the timing assertions trip. We now disable compression below 512 bytes in the test harness; production keeps it on for bulk streams. Reviewers should compare against the passing reference run, token below.

pipeline stamp: htk6_7941f2

Subject: JV with Copperfen — quick heads-up

Hi all,

Wanted to loop the finance team in early: Bramleigh Works is close to terms on a joint venture with Copperfen Logistics covering the northern distribution lanes. We'd contribute warehousing capacity; they bring fleet and routing tech. Early modeling looks solid, though working capital needs in year one are heavier than first assumed. Nothing signed yet, so please keep this tight. We'll walk through the numbers Tuesday. The broader intent is summarized in the note below.

Cheers,
Dorin

internal memo for hahif-hahaf: Headcount on the Zorwyn team goes from 9 to 100 by the end of October. Gross margin on Zorwyn came in at 5 percent against a plan of 10 percent.

## Formula sandbox tuning

User-supplied formulas in Gridmoor execute inside a restricted interpreter with hard ceilings on time, memory, and call depth. Reviewers should confirm any change to these ceilings is justified in the PR description, since raising them widens the abuse surface. Defaults were chosen from production traces. The current limits are as follows.

limits module of tafog-fawip:
WEIGHTS = {
    "julix": 57,
    "lamys": 992,
    "kasvan": 209,
    "quenok": 750,
    "alddor": 259,
    "oliath": 1009,
    "wenix": 815,
}